Air suspension crossing fingers!
So... Bagpipe Andy's miracle kit fitted and I have lift back! Fault codes revealed 1577 Shut off due to overheating
1772 implausible signal wire for pressure sender 1400 lower limit not achieved All classed as Sporadic.... Functions up and down are much quicker so clearly psi is back up. For the price of 2 hours labour and the kit, it would be lovely if all is now well. The old piston ring did not seem that worn but was scored underneath. |

What kit are you talking about?? What was the fault?? Can you share more info unless I'm the only one who don't know what it is then still please share ;) Cheers |
Sure... Kit is a replacement piston ring and seal for the compressor. It restores pressure and is a cheap, worthwhile and very efficient fix assuming the compressor motor itself is still ok.
This bagpipe Andy guy is on eBay and is an engineer who makes the parts. Does a similar repair for high end Mercs, the Jag XJ and Discovery etc. Go to eBay and search Air suspension repair and he'll appear! My compressor was working overtime and took a long time to raise and lower etc. Now it is much better. I'm just hoping I haven't got a problem on the wiring block itself. Time will tell. So after a day or two of driving with the refurbed compressor, I'm impressed! The rear seems higher and in line with the front now. It may be placebo, but I'm sure the ride is a little firmer and less wallowy which is a good thing.
The guy that made this kit up deserves a real accolade for his talent and ability to save all air ride drivers a packet. On the motorway tomorrow, so will see how she fares in Automatic. Previously very reluctant to hoist back up to comfort or slow to do so after having been in Dynamic for a while. |
